2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L Problems

Are you planning to buy a 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L? Before making a decision, it’s crucial to know about any potential problems that might arise. In this article, we’ll discuss some common issues reported by owners of the 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L.

One problem that has been brought up is with the transmission. Some drivers have experienced rough shifting or hesitation when accelerating. This can be frustrating and may require a visit to the dealership for diagnosis and repairs. Another concern shared by owners is related to the electrical system. A few individuals have encountered issues with the infotainment system freezing or restarting unexpectedly. While these occurrences are relatively rare, they can still be an inconvenience.

Additionally, there have been reports of paint quality problems on certain vehicles. Some owners have noticed chips, peeling, or fading in the paint, especially on the hood or roof. Keep in mind that this issue might not affect all vehicles and could be attributed to individual cases or specific manufacturing batches.

Owners Report Persistent Electrical Issues in the 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L: What’s Causing the Problem?

Are you a proud owner of the 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L? If so, you might have come across some persistent electrical issues that have left you scratching your head. In this article, we will delve into the possible causes of these problems and shed some light on what might be going wrong.

One common issue reported by owners is a recurring problem with the vehicle’s electrical system. Imagine driving down the road, enjoying a smooth ride, only to have the lights flicker or the dashboard display go haywire. It can be frustrating and even dangerous! So, what could be causing these electrical gremlins?

One potential culprit could be faulty wiring. Like the nervous system in our bodies, the wiring in a car carries electrical signals to various components. Over time, wires can become frayed or damaged, resulting in intermittent connectivity or short circuits. This can lead to erratic behavior in the electronics of the vehicle, causing the aforementioned issues.

Another possible cause is a malfunctioning alternator. The alternator is responsible for generating electricity and charging the battery while the engine is running. If the alternator is not functioning properly, it may not provide a consistent power supply to the electrical system, resulting in glitches and malfunctions.

Moreover, the onboard computer system, known as the Body Control Module (BCM), could be contributing to the electrical woes. The BCM controls and monitors various electrical functions in the vehicle, from the headlights to the power windows. If the BCM is experiencing a glitch or software malfunction, it can cause a range of electrical problems throughout the vehicle.

So, what can you do if you’re experiencing these issues? Firstly, it’s important to contact your local Jeep dealership or a certified mechanic to diagnose and address the problem. They have the expertise and tools to pinpoint the exact cause and recommend the appropriate solution.

While the 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L is a remarkable vehicle, some owners have encountered persistent electrical issues. Faulty wiring, a malfunctioning alternator, or problems with the Body Control Module could be the root causes. To resolve these issues, seeking professional assistance is crucial. Transmission Woes: Customers Voice Frustration Over Gear Shifting Problems in the 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L

Are you a proud owner of the 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L? While this SUV boasts impressive features and off-road capabilities, some customers have been left frustrated by transmission issues. Gear shifting problems seem to be the main culprit, causing annoyance among Jeep enthusiasts. Let’s delve into the details of these transmission woes and understand why customers are voicing their concerns.

2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ee L Problems

One common issue that has been reported is the rough shifting between gears. Instead of experiencing smooth transitions, drivers have noticed jerky movements when accelerating or decelerating. Imagine the frustration of driving your brand-new Grand Cherokee L, only to be met with lurching gear changes that disrupt your overall driving experience. It’s no wonder customers are speaking up about this problem.

Another cause for concern is the delay in gear engagement. Some owners have complained about a noticeable lag when shifting gears, especially from park to drive or reverse. This delay can be worrisome, leading to uncertainty and potential safety hazards in certain situations. After all, when you press the accelerator, you expect an immediate response, not a frustrating hesitation.

Jeep Grand Cherokee L owners expect their vehicles to provide a seamless and enjoyable driving experience. Unfortunately, these transmission issues have cast a shadow on that expectation. The dissatisfaction appears to stem from a combination of mechanical and software-related problems within the transmission system.

Jeep acknowledges these concerns and has been actively working on solutions. They’ve released software updates aimed at addressing the gear shifting problems. Additionally, they are offering support to affected customers through their service centers, where skilled technicians are equipped to diagnose and resolve these transmission woes.
